The history of Ashford Castle

Ashford Castle, nestled in the stunning County Mayo in the west of Ireland, boasts a rich and captivating history that spans centuries.

Originally built in the 13th century as a defensive stronghold, the castle has witnessed countless events and transformations throughout its existence.


Ownership history of the castle

The castle’s earliest roots can be traced back to 1228 when it was constructed by the Anglo-Norman de Burgos family.

Over the years, Ashford Castle passed through the hands of various noble families, each leaving their mark on the castle’s architecture and legacy.

In the early 19th century, the Guinness family, famous for their brewery empire, took ownership of the castle and transformed it into a luxurious estate.

During the ownership of the Guinness family, significant renovations and expansions were carried out, turning Ashford Castle into a grand Victorian mansion.

The castle’s iconic turrets, elegant interiors, and stunning gardens were crafted during this period, solidifying its reputation as a lavish and opulent retreat.

Throughout the 20th century, this historic castle transitioned from the former home of the Guinness family to its new chapter as a luxury hotel.

Notably, in 1939, the castle was purchased by Noel Huggard, who transformed it into one of Ireland’s premier hotels, welcoming illustrious guests from around the world.


Famous guests of the castle

Over the years, Ashford Castle has hosted many notable figures, including royalty, politicians, and celebrities, further enhancing its allure and prestige.

Its rich history and architectural beauty have also made it a popular filming location, with appearances in films such as “The Quiet Man” starring John Wayne.

Some famous figures who have visited Ashford Castle include Pierce Brosnan, John Wayne, Brad Pitt, John Lennon, Robin Williams, President Ronald Reagan, and Maureen O’Hara.

Where is Ashford Castle Hotel located?

Ashford Castle is located in County Mayo, Ireland, on the County Galway border. Nestled near the picturesque village of Cong, the castle sits on the shores of Lough Corrib, Ireland’s second-largest lake.

The serene setting of Ashford Castle is surrounded by lush countryside, rolling hills, and enchanting woodlands, which provide a tranquil escape from the outside world.

This is one of the best photo spots in Ireland!

There are several transportation options available to reach Ashford Castle.

The nearest international airport is Ireland West Airport Knock, located approximately 45 kilometers (28 miles) away, offering convenient connections to major cities.

Additionally, Galway Airport and Shannon Airport are also within reasonable distance.

For those traveling by train, the nearest railway station is in Galway City, with regular services connecting to other parts of Ireland.

Ashford Castle is easily accessible by road as well, with well-maintained routes leading to the castle from major cities and towns.

There are seven Ashford Castle restaurants:

  • The Dungeon
  • George V Dining Room
  • The Connaught Room
  • Cullen’s at the Cottage
  • The Drawing Room
  • Stanley’s
  • The Prince of Wales Bar

The Dungeon Restaurant

Hidden beneath Ashford Castle lies the Dungeon Restaurant, an extraordinary dining experience that transports guests to a bygone era.

Descend into the castle’s depths and immerse yourself in a captivating dungeon surrounded by stone walls and flickering candlelight.

The menu here features traditional Irish dishes. Guests can expect a blend of classic and contemporary flavors, with options ranging from succulent meats and seafood to vegetarian dishes.

Each plate is thoughtfully designed to provide a remarkable dining experience within the captivating setting of the castle’s underground sanctuary.

The Dungeon Restaurant in Ashford Castle. The walls are red and there are pendants with family crests hanging from the ceiling. There are tables set throughout the room.
The Dungeon Restaurant in Ashford Castle

George V Dining Room

The George V Dining Room, named for King George V, at Ashford Castle, is the fanciest dining room in the castle.

Named after the former king of England, this dining room exudes timeless elegance with its grand crystal chandeliers, ornate ceilings, and luxurious furnishings.

The menu features a symphony of gourmet creations, showcasing the finest local and seasonal ingredients and offering a fine dining experience fit for royalty.

You can choose to indulge in a 5-course meal or order a la carte.

Note: Men are required to wear a jacket to dinner, and dressing up is strongly encouraged for everyone.

The George V Dining Room is also where breakfast is served every morning.

You can choose from various options, including a traditional Irish breakfast, omelets, pancakes, and more. We thoroughly enjoyed our breakfasts here!


The Connaught Room

The Connaught Room is mainly used for afternoon tea, which I briefly mentioned earlier.

This stunning dining room includes features like floor-to-ceiling windows, an ornate wooden fireplace, and a stunning Donegal Crystal chandelier.

During afternoon tea at Ashford Castle, you can experience a delightful array of finger sandwiches, an extensive selection of hot teas, and an assortment of freshly baked goods and treats, including mouth-watering scones and an enticing assortment of pastries.

This experience allows guests to immerse themselves in a truly enchanting tea-time experience that is second to none.

Read more about our experience having afternoon tea at Ashford Castle here!


Cullen’s at the Cottage

Set in a quaint thatched cottage adjacent to the castle, the Cullen’s at the Cottage restaurant offers a cozy and inviting ambiance.

Guests can indulge in hearty and flavorsome dishes that celebrate the best of Irish cuisine and explore additional worldwide dishes.

Fun fact: This cottage used to house the Cong Cinema. It was also where the very first viewing of The Quiet Man was shown, even before it was released in Hollywood!


The Drawing Room

The Drawing Room is perfect for a quick lunch or a very early dinner. The food here was really delicious!

While drinks are served here all day, food is only available from 12-6 and serves a variety of soups, sandwiches, and a few main courses.

The main draw to this dining location is the gorgeous views of the castle grounds and Lake Corrib out of the massive windows.

You’ll find yourself tempted to linger for a bit after your meal to take in the stunning landscape.


Stanley’s

Stanley’s has a bright and fun atmosphere. This restaurant only seats nine people at a bar overlooking an open kitchen.

This darling restaurant is decorated like a diner with green and white wallpaper, green barstools, and a picture of Elvis Presley hanging on the wall.

Reservations are not accepted here, and there is no dress code, making it an informal and fun place to grab a bite to eat.

The menu features fresh options, including salads, sandwiches, and burgers.


The Prince of Wales Bar

And finally, we have the Prince of Wales Bar.

This gorgeous room is decorated with rich shades of green and ornate wooden paneling, with a stunning chandelier in the center.

The Prince of Wales visited in 1905 and this room was used as his private bar during his stay at Ashford Castle.

Today, this lounge is a great place to hang out for a relaxing drink. We enjoyed iced teas here while we waited for our room to be ready for check-in.

Make as many reservations as you can in advance

Make as many reservations as possible in advance to avoid disappointment and give yourself a better experience.

This includes dining reservations, spa services, and experiences you may want to enjoy on the estate.

Things tend to fill up very quickly and might be booked entirely by the time you arrive.

Additionally, some activities require pre-booking so that adequate staff may be available.


Most of the castle is only available for guests staying at the castle

Most of the castle is only available for guests staying at the castle, so please don’t show up hoping to explore and leave. You will be disappointed if so!

Some of the restaurants are available for those not staying at the castle, but they must be booked in advance.

Even if you dine in the castle, there will still be off-limits areas to those who aren’t overnight guests.
